MUMBAI, NOV 17: Mumbai off-spinner Aziz Sheikh8217;s five-wicket haul restricted Saurashtra8217;s surge in the West Zone under-19 Cooch-Behar league match at the Brabourne Stadium here today. Put into bat, Saurashtra were served well by 82-run opening stand between Prashant Joshi 69: 212b, 7215;4 and Sandeep Dharajiya 56: 95b, 11215;4. But Sheikh8217;s snatched the initiative and Saurashtra had to be content with 207 for eight on the board at close of the opening day8217;s play.

Mumbai, with 9 points in their kitty are desperately seeking an outright victory to make the knockout grade. Gujarat 21 has already qualified leaving, Maharashtra 13 points, Saurashtra 13, Mumbai and Vadodara 8 to slug it out for the remaining second spot.

Brief scores: Saurashtra 207-8 P Joshi 69, S Dharajiya 56, Nikhil Rathod 29; A Sheikh 5-47 vs Mumbai.

Vadodara well-set

PUNE: Vadodara upset Maharashtra8217;s calculations while cruising to an impressive 280 for six at stumps on the first day of the three-day Cooch Behar Trophy under-19 cricket match at Deccan Gymkhana today.

Thanks to an unbroken seventh-wicket stand of 72 between Shekhar Joshi 36: 65b, 2215;4, 3215;6 and Imran Phatan 45: 98b, 5215;4, 1215;6 the underdogs, out of contention for a place in the knockout, now threaten the hosts8217; hopes of making the grade.

Earlier, Hrishikesh Parab8217;s impressive 95 157b, 198m, 14215;4 had laid the foundations after a middle-order collapse.

Brief Scores: Vadodara 280-6 in 92 overs Hrishikesh Parab 95; Jitendra Singh 40; Imran Phatan batting 45, Shekhar Joshi batting 36; Kashinath Khadkikar 2-92 vs Maharashtra.
